What Is Treatment And How It Works?

Saxenda injection in Dubai(حقن ساكسيندا في دبي) is an injectable medication designed to help individuals manage their weight by mimicking a naturally occurring hormone that regulates appetite. By slowing gastric emptying and increasing feelings of fullness, it reduces overall calorie intake, complementing healthy lifestyle choices.

The importance of this treatment lies in its ability to support long-term behavioral changes. While Saxenda aids in appetite control, its effectiveness depends on maintaining proper diet and physical activity habits. Understanding how the treatment works provides insight into what may happen after stopping the medication, as appetite and hunger cues may gradually return to pre-treatment levels without continued behavioral support.

Potential Risks After Stopping:

  • Increased hunger and appetite

  • Gradual weight regain

  • Return of previous eating patterns without continued behavioral strategies

Proactive planning, including dietary and exercise routines, is essential to maintain weight loss and support long-term health.

FAQs:

Q: Will I regain weight immediately after stopping Saxenda?
A: Weight regain may occur gradually, especially if healthy habits are not maintained.

Q: How can I maintain results after discontinuing Saxenda?
A: Continued healthy eating, regular physical activity, and tracking progress are key to sustaining results.

Q: Are there any withdrawal effects?
A: Most side effects resolve after stopping, but appetite may increase temporarily.

Q: Can Saxenda be restarted if weight is regained?
A: Reinitiating treatment is possible, but adherence and long-term strategies are important for sustained success.

Q: How soon after stopping should I adjust my routine?
A: Begin focusing on lifestyle adjustments immediately to minimize weight regain.
